In the locker room, April is gasping over Mere's ring finger, which shows the fruit of her engagement the night before. Mere asks if she is okay and says she knew it would be hard for her but April assures her it's fine. It seems that there was never a shooting in Elttaes, because Charles is alive and well and seems to be pining after April now though she's not interested. Mere tells April that she's the first person to know after Mere's parents because April is her "person." April assures Mere -- maybe a little too much -- that she is thrilled, and says that maybe they will become the next Shepherds. Mere starts to tell April the story of how he asked, but they are interrupted when the door opens and "Ruby Blue" starts playing. In Elttaes, Cristina's song is the very song that accompanied her burst fallopian tube from her ectopic pregnancy in Seattle. This Cristina also has flat-ironed hair, in addition to some bangs. Oh, and the resident scrubs here are grey, and the women have special girly-cut scrubs with more of a scoop neck rather than just wearing the same ones as the guys. Who knew Ellis would be so fond of distinguishing the genders? Jackson tries to wish Cristina good morning and she bites his head off; Cristina warns him not to feed the animals. So, it's Cristina with the attitude we know and love but without the humanity she has gained from her friendship with Mere.

But if Cristina is just a more concentrated version of her Seattle self, Alex is instead his complete and utter opposite. He walks in wearing a purple polo shirt and some Buddy Holly glasses and proceeds to be the team cheerleader. In a way it's his job since he appears to be Chief Resident, but peppy team leader Alex is almost frightening. April tells them she's on "Good" Shepherd's service that day (for now we have to guess who that is) while Charles is delighted that he's on "Bad" Shepherd's service and can use this as an awkward entry to try to flirt some more with April. As the others leave, Alex asks Dr. Webber (!!) if she can stay behind and once he and Meredith are alone, they start making out in earnest. They are all gooey about their engagement but Alex is especially interested in hearing how Ellis reacted and seems thrilled when Mere assures him that she was happy and she loves him. Oh lordy, as she lifts her hand we see that she's wearing a pink watch, too. It's like she's taking style tips from Barbie. The two flirt about how he was a jerk before he met her, but she knew there was a good guy inside. I'm sure that in Elttaes, he's not got a self-destructive streak buried deep inside like he does in the real world.
